Ernest Szoka

Excellent, been to the brasserie a few times and keep coming back. Stand outs are the octopus, mushroom gnocchi and lobtser farro risotto. Steak and fries, sausage and duck confit are very good. Dishes are not large but are elevated by their consistant and excellent execution, the seafood and meat are always super tender. Place is open everyday and generally very busy, can get a bit loud.
